Data stores — Bramblefork assignment service. Variant definitions live in the experiments schema; per-user assignments are cached in Pintle and persisted asynchronously. Reviewers should note that writes are idempotent on (user, experiment) and that schema changes require a dual-write window. Local verification against the staging persistence tier should use the connection string provided immediately below.

primary connection of yagep-kahip = redis://giliel_svc:zYiKsLL2PLpfPL@db-348f.xolmarsys.corp:5432/fenwyn

### Step 4: Enable telemetry compression

Heads up, future maintainers: the Pinloft collector now gzips telemetry batches before shipping them upstream, cutting egress by roughly 70%. Older agents that can't decompress will be rejected, so upgrade agents first. Once everything's on version 3 or later, apply the compression settings that follow.

service settings:
PRAIX_LOG_LEVEL=error
PRAIX_METRICS_HOST=metrics.praix.qorvelcorp.corp
PRAIX_POOL_SIZE=16

## QueueScaler Onboarding — Security Notes

The Drosselwerk autoscaler (codename Pellin) scales workers on queue depth from the Tarnby broker. Scaling decisions are signed; unsigned directives are dropped. Thresholds live in versioned config, changes require two approvals. Max scale-out is capped at 40 pods to limit blast radius. Metrics are read-only via a scoped service account. Review scaling audit logs weekly. If the signing keypair must be regenerated during an incident, unlock the sealed escrow bundle with the passphrase below.

unlock words, yawig-kagef: gordor-holvan-ulaael-pramir-ulaiel-tamdor

### Inventory Reconciliation Job

Welcome aboard! The Tallygrove reconciliation job runs nightly, diffing warehouse counts against the Ordermarsh ledger and flagging mismatches over 2%. You can trigger it manually via `POST /recon/run` if a client screams about stock drift. It's idempotent, so don't stress about double-runs. To call the endpoint from your dev box, authenticate with the key below.

API key for yahig-tadup: kto7_ubizbYm